ABSTRACT:
Exchange Server 2007 is as self-healing as Exchange has ever been, but without a healthy hardware platform, drivers, Active Directory, DNS, network, and regular policy management, it can go belly-up faster than you can say cardiac arrest. To make matters even worse, many Exchange administrators are not current with the latest CPR techniques nor have they been practicing preventive maintenance on their Exchange databases in order to minimize unplanned downtime.
This white paper explains the bare and necessary facts you should know to proactively maintain your Exchange Server 2007 environment. In addition to providing critical strategies for predicting and responding to failures, it also provides useful information for implementing proactive measures to ensure that your investment is well protected.

Author
Steve Bryant
Microsoft Exchange MVP
,
Microsoft
Steve Bryant is a nationally recognized authority on Microsoft Exchange designs, having spent the past decade reviewing, developing, and deploying some of the largest Exchange implementations in the country. In 2002, Microsoft hired him to create and deliver the highly regarded Secured Connected Infrastructure training course, and in 2003 the company retained Steve to co-author the book Secure Messaging with Microsoft Exchange Server 2000.<br/>
